The Brenton Butler case (officially State of Florida v. Brenton Leonard Butler) was a murder case in Jacksonville, Florida. The case gained significant notice in the media, and became the subject of an award-winning documentary, Murder on a Sunday Morning. The Butler case was the subject of the French documentary film Murder on a Sunday Morning, which won the Academy Award for Best Documentary Feature at the 74th Academy Awards in 2001. Section 90.804(2)(c), Florida Statutes (2001) excludes from the hearsay rule: [a]statement which, at the time of its making, was so far contrary to the declarant's pecuniary or proprietary interest or tended to subject the declarant to liability or to render invalid a claim by the declarant against another, so that a person in the declarant's position would not have made the statement unless he or she believed it to be true.
